...Except Ethiopia, and the arabic countries, all african countries are using european colonial languages as the only official languages for public administration.
You can’t write a letter in Yoruba, Ibo, Hausa to the Nigerian public administration and receive an answer in the same language.
Europe is a very small continent. 3 times smaller than Africa, 4 times smaller than America. The combined sized of all EU countries is smaller than the US or China, and the whole European continent is just the size of the African Sahara area. Madagascar is more than 2 times bigger than the UK, and Congo is 5 times the size of France.
If the small EU can manage 24 working languages, how can’t the Big Nigeria manage at least 3 to 5 working languages in their parliament or public administration?
